The Equality Act is proposed federal legislation that would establish non-discrimination protections for LGBTQ+ Americans in employment, housing, public accommodations, public education, federal funding, credit, and the jury system.

What is the Equality Act?

The Equality Act is a landmark LGBTQ+ civil rights bill introduced in the United States Congress over 20 years ago. If passed, it would update the Civil Rights Act to prohibit discrimination on the basis of sexual orientation and gender identity in employment, housing, public accommodations, public education, federal funding, credit, and the jury system. Passage of the Equality Act would provide LGBTQ+ people nationwide with protection against discrimination.

Why is it important for Jewish communities to support the Equality Act?

Given the role of many faith communities in opposing LGBTQ+ rights, Congress needs to hear from Jews and other pro-equality people of faith that we support the passage of the Equality Act. We must speak out – not despite our religious tradition, but because of our ethical mandate to fight for human dignity and justice.
